A leading engineering staffing provider in the United Kingdom is seeking an experienced E&I Design Engineer for a major nuclear project in Risley. This hybrid role requires a minimum of 3 years' experience in electrical design, focusing on multidiscipline projects and a strong knowledge of engineering standards.
Responsibilities include:
- Delivering and supporting design packages
- Providing assurance to construction and commissioning
The position offers career development opportunities and participation in a significant nuclear project over the next 2-3 years.
